        To convert kilograms to pounds, you can use the inverse of the conversion factor. Divide the number of kilograms by 0.453592 to get the equivalent weight in pounds.

      • Weight conversion is a simple process that involves understanding the relationship between two different units of measurement. Pounds and kilograms are two of the most commonly used units in the world. One pound is equivalent to 0.453592 kilograms. To convert pounds to kilograms, you can simply multiply the number of pounds by 0.453592.

        For example, if you want to know how much 119 pounds weighs in kilograms, you can multiply 119 by 0.453592. This will give you the equivalent weight in kilograms.
